Best tourists attractions: Botswana

Botswana is a cool place to visit! It’s in Africa, and it has lots of amazing things to see.

Chobe National Park: In this park, there are loads of elephants. Take a boat trip on the Chobe River, and you’ll see elephants and other animals enjoying the water.

Moremi Game Reserve: This area in the Okavango Delta is like a giant home for lions, leopards, cheetahs, and many types of birds.

Central Kalahari Game Reserve: This is one of the biggest places for animals. It’s like a vast, empty desert where animals roam freely.

Cultural Villages: Visit local villages to learn about their traditions, watch traditional dances, and see beautiful art.

Budapest

Best tourists attractions: Budapest is an amazing city to visit! It’s the capital of Hungary, and it’s full of interesting things to see and do.

Thermal Baths: Budapest is famous for its thermal baths. These are like big, relaxing pools with warm water. It’s a great way to unwind and enjoy the unique experience.

Buda Castle: Imagine a big, old castle on a hill. That’s Buda Castle! You can explore inside, and from there, you get a fantastic view of the city.

Chain Bridge: There’s a special bridge called the Chain Bridge that connects Buda and Pest (two parts of the city). It looks beautiful, especially at night when it’s all lit up.

Margaret Island: Right in the middle of the Danube River, there’s an island called Margaret Island. It’s a peaceful place with parks, gardens, and even a musical fountain.

Best tourists attractions: Mongolia

Mongolia is a fascinating country with a unique blend of vast landscapes, nomadic culture, and rich history. Here’s a glimpse into what makes Mongolia a special destination:

Gobi Desert: Imagine a vast desert with towering sand dunes and rocky landscapes. The Gobi Desert is home to unique wildlife like wild camels and elusive snow leopards.

Nomadic Culture: A significant part of Mongolia’s population is still nomadic, living in traditional felt tents called gers. You can experience their hospitality, taste traditional food, and learn about their way of life.

Terelj National Park: This is a stunning national park with granite rock formations, alpine meadows, and the famous Turtle Rock. It’s close to the capital, Ulaanbaatar, making it a popular destination.

French Polynesia

French Polynesia is a beautiful collection of islands in the South Pacific Ocean. Here are some interesting things about this tropical paradise:

Tahiti: This is the largest island and is famous for its vibrant markets, black sand beaches, and lush landscapes. The capital, Papeete, is a hub of French Polynesian culture.

Overwater Bungalows: French Polynesia is famous for its luxurious overwater bungalows, allowing you to stay right above the clear, blue waters with direct access to the lagoon.

Moorea: Just a short ferry ride from Tahiti, Moorea is known for its volcanic peaks, pineapple plantations, and diverse marine life. You can explore the island’s beauty through various outdoor activities.

Ecuador

Amazon Rainforest: A big part of the Amazon Rainforest is in Ecuador. It’s like a jungle with lots of plants, animals, and cool adventures.

Andes Mountains: Ecuador has tall mountains called the Andes. People here live in high places, and you can see beautiful landscapes with snowy peaks.

Cotopaxi Volcano: Imagine a big mountain that sometimes has snow on top. That’s Cotopaxi! It’s a volcano, but don’t worry, it’s not erupting all the time.

Pacific Coast: Ecuador has a beautiful coastline along the Pacific Ocean. You can find lovely beaches and enjoy the sea breeze.

Quito: This is the capital city. It’s high up in the mountains and has a historic old town that’s really pretty. You can see colorful markets and learn about Ecuador’s history.
